Transaction aa730643a5afacb598a10b07b547986a803d8d890365660b6f1d58dc4a2f600d
1 Input
1 Outputs
- aa730643a5afacb598a10b07b547986a803d8d890365660b6f1d58dc4a2f600d:0
value 3585120
address 3GSqtm21GmR96F3mhTSfZ9yQxxu6nN6Xxk